首页 > TAG信息列表 > Composable

Jetpack Compose What and Why, 6个问题,2021高级Android笔试总结

修复和更新了一些旧的API: (Buggy Android Views: Picker, Spinner, EditText, 有一些edge cases. 因为要更改旧的总是很难, 不如创建一个新的. )基于组合的Composable, 比基于继承的View体系, 更加灵活, 易于复用. 比如可以通过组合来达到复用多个源, 不再受单继承限制. 以B

Compose概述

文章目录 系列文章目录前言一、pandas是什么?二、使用步骤 1.引入库2.读入数据总结   一、Compose概述 示例:pa Jetpack Compose 是Google发布的一个Android原生现代UI工具包,它完全采用Kotlin编写,是一套声明式UI框架,可以使用Kotlin语言的全部特性,可以帮助你轻松、快速的构建

Dialog 按照顺序弹窗,超全Android中高级面试复习大纲

allprojects { repositories { … maven { url ‘https://jitpack.io’ } } } 在 module 的 build.gradle 中引入 ComposeWaveLoading 的最新版本 dependencies { implementation ‘com.github.vitaviva:ComposeWaveLoading:$latest_version’ } 2. API 设计思想 ===========

Android现有工程使用Compose

Android现有工程使用Compose 看了Compose的示例工程后,我们也想使用Compose。基于目前情况,在现有工程基础上添加Compose功能。 引入Compose 首先我们安装 Android Studio Arctic Fox 或更高版本。 项目的配置gradle/wrapper/gradle-wrapper.properties distributionUrl=https\://se

Jetpack Compose---> Navigation组件的基本使用

Navigation结合Compose基本使用总结 添加依赖 implementation "androidx.navigation:navigation-compose:2.4.0-alpha06" 无参路由 NavController: val navController = rememberNavController() NavHost NavGraphBuilder:它是NavHost的最后一个参数,可以使用尾随的la

compose 基础

确保您选择的最小sdkversion至少是API级别21,这是Compose支持的最小API。 @Composable fun Greeting(name: String) { Surface(color = Color.Yellow) { Text (text = "Hello $name!") } } The components nested inside Surface will be drawn on top of

【原创】Jetpack Compose学习笔记(一)

Jetpack Compose学习笔记(一) Jetpack Compose是Google推出的全新的UI框架。很多人都说学不动了,但是作为一个程序员,学不动也要学哦,不然就会被淘汰。 目录结构 HelloWorld式这里就免了,新建工程的目录结构就这个样子,默认新建了一个主题的包,同时在res目录下也没有了layout目录。Compo